Good morning. On the African plain there is an elephant. On the beast’s back there is a hair. You can’t see it, but it is there. There are thousands and thousands of parts and pieces of the elephant hidden inside. We can’t see those parts either, but they are there. There is dirt on the elephant’s feet, and something sticky near the end of its trunk. We can’t see those things, but along with a million other unseen bits, inside and out, they are there. And they are on the list.
What list? Glad you asked, because it is a marvelous list: For in him all things were created: things in heaven and on earth, visible and invisible, whether thrones or powers or rulers or authorities; all things have been created through him and for him. Colossians 1:16
You are on that list, and so am I. The tiny baby that just had its first heartbeat inside its mother’s womb, that baby is included. That elderly person who is breathing their final breath, yes, they are there. Nothing is too big, and nothing is too small to not be included on that list.
In the beginning was the Word, and the Word was with God, and the Word was God. He was with God in the beginning. Through him all things were made; without him nothing was made that has been made. In him was life, and that life was the light of all mankind. The light shines in the darkness, and the darkness has not overcome it. John 1:1-5
The Creator of all things came into this world as a part of Creation. Yes, He, as the baby who was carefully placed in the manger, is on the list. Incredible.
We should celebrate!
